Accountancy firm steps up to back big race days
PKF Cooper Parry is to become title sponsor of the Simplyhealth Great Birmingham Run and Great Birmingham 10K Business Challenge events.
The Edgbaston accountancy practice will sponsor this year’s two Business Challenge events, which invite companies from across the Midlands to compete and become the fastest teams.
The PKF Cooper Parry Business Challenge is open to small, medium and large businesses in the Great Birmingham 10K on Sunday, April 30, and the Great Birmingham Run half marathon on Sunday, October 15 – the same day as the inaugural Birmingham International Marathon.
Trophies are handed out to winning businesses and any company that enters 12 or more employees will receive an engraved plaque in the name of the fastest runner in the team.
The four fastest collective times by participants are added up for each team to pick the overall winners.
Over 60 teams took part in last year’s Great Birmingham Run and 10K Business Challenges, from a variety of business sectors and sizes across the Midlands.
